MIS2025-002 — Residential fence with cedar pickets on street-facing sides in Rockwall, TX
This case involves a request for an exception to fence material requirements in an established residential subdivision. The applicant constructed an 8-foot metal panel fence with cedar posts to replace an existing cedar fence, which does not comply with neighborhood material standards. The applicant is seeking approval to add cedar pickets to street-facing sides to achieve architectural compatibility with existing neighborhood fencing.
